Class BurndownColumnChangeFactory

java.lang.Object
com.atlassian.greenhopper.web.rapid.chart.burndown.BurndownColumnChangeFactory

@Service public class BurndownColumnChangeFactory extends Object
Factory for burndown column changes. The Factory takes all columns configured in the rapid board and merges all but the last together into a single column.
  • Constructor Details

    • BurndownColumnChangeFactory

      public BurndownColumnChangeFactory()
  • Method Details

    • getBurndownColumnChangeData

      public ServiceOutcome<BurndownColumnChangeData> getBurndownColumnChangeData(com.atlassian.jira.user.ApplicationUser user, RapidView rapidView, Collection<String> issueKeys)
      Get the burndown column changes for a set of issues TODO: this method currently searches the issues using issueKey in ... which doesn't scale well (1 db call per issue!)